Subtle Bodies

Many spiritual systems hold a concept of what is called subtle bodies. Subtle bodies
refer to specific regions of your spiritual composition that results in your physical incarnation here on earth. In
my work I use a four-fold model... although in other systems they further divide the bodies even more. I have found
that this is simply not necessary. Think of a cake, divide it into four pieces or twelve, it is still a
cake.
So, in a nutshell (working from the inside out) there is:
1) The Physical Body: OK, this is the bit we see every day. If you are not familiar with
your physical body, time to get aquainted with it.
2) The Etheric Body: This is the life force that animates the physical body. Over
time it is depleted which results in our death. Its "directon" is to expand and grow.
3) The Astral Body: This is the seat of karmic and emotional memory. It is the realm
of the mind where our thoughts and emotion originate. Parts of the astral body survive death (see here for more information on that). It's "direction" is to
contract and grasp.
4) The Ego / Higher Self: This is the divine you that is eternal. Note the reference here
to Ego with a capital "E", as opposed to ego with a little "e". Ego with the little "e" refers to the construct
that we believe to be "me", as opposed to Ego with the big "E" which is divine love and purity (the real
"you").

This diagram shows the model in a simplified onion-like fashion, and is very common representation of
subtle body theory. However, it is tempting to see this as each body being a separate entity. This is not the case.
The inter-relationships between the bodies are much more complex, as each body completely permeates the
others.
This model is then further refined into the Upper Complex and the Lower Complex. The Upper Complex
consists of the Ego and Astral Bodies. The Lower Complex the Etheric and Physical Bodies.

As I mentioned earlier, the Etheric body seeks to expand and grow, where as the Astral Body seeks to contract
and grasp. This friction between the Etheric and Astral Body results in a slow wearing away of the Astral body
(we call this aging) and the need for sleep.
During sleep the upper complex (Astral and Ego) seperate from the lower complex (Physical and Etheric). This
allows the etheric and astral bodies to "recharge". This is why if you get no sleep you feel like crap and can not
think "clearly" (remember the Astral Body is the realm of thought and emotion).
